
Episode 397: Nick Byrd – Pinsomniacs Pinball
There's a growing pinball scene in Jacksonville, Florida, and a Nick Byrd & Pinsomniacs Pinball is a big part of it. Hear the high-flying stories from Nick, his competitive bug, love for The...
Highlights
- Pinsomniacs operates pinball machines across three Jacksonville locations: Video Game Rescue, Teppies brewery, and Throwbacks.
- The Jacksonville Pinberg satellite event is the only one in Florida and has 68 slots for group match play on June 1st.
- The Pinberg golden ticket is worth $350 and the main event has 144 people just outside Pittsburgh in July with 25,000+ in total prizing.
- Nick has completed approximately 1,600 skydives and works as a skydive instructor at iFly indoor skydiving facility.
- Nick's Elvis pinball machine is approximately 20 years old and was purchased new-in-box from Old Town Pinball about a year ago.
Notable quotes
“Like when I was a kid, I remember my mom dropping me off at the Aladdin's Castle so she could shop in the mall and give me some quarters, and they had a Judge Dredd and Attack from Mars, and those games just kind of pulled me in.”
“For me, it's almost a level of awe. I mean, everybody's playing so much better than me... the way some of these pro-level players are just, they can play, you know, they're on Godzilla and they're knocking out of the park and then we switch gears and we go over to something like Creature, and they don't miss a beat.”
“I can't think of anything else where you get to play a hobby or a sport and get to be against and amongst the best in the world.”
“When you leave that plane, there's only one thing going on, and it's that moment on that skydive, and everything else just kind of melts away.”
“I have the nicest Elvis pinball machine on the planet, and you can play it at Teppies.”
